Practical Guidance for Using a Script Typeface

Choosing a font is a strategic decision, not just an aesthetic one. When evaluating Curvy Script for a project, start by considering the core message. Does your brand or project call for elegance, energy, or approachability? This typeface leans toward friendly sophistication. Its strength is in display use, so it’s rarely the right choice for long paragraphs of body copy. For readability in extended text, always pair it with a highly legible serif font or sans serif font. A classic combination might be Curvy Script for headlines with a font like Lato or Open Sans for the supporting text. This creates a clear visual hierarchy, guiding the reader through your content.

Before committing to a final design, always test the font in context. How does it look at the exact size you’ll use it? Does it maintain its clarity when printed on textured paper or viewed on a small mobile screen? Check the font package for included styles—does it offer multiple weights or alternate characters? These extras can provide valuable flexibility. Crucially, for any commercial project, verify the licensing. A commercial font like Curvy Script will come with a license that outlines permissible uses, from digital products to physical merchandise. Understanding this ensures your use is compliant and professional, protecting both your work and the font creator’s rights.
